Easy Vegan Peanut Butter Mousse Recipe

This vegan peanut butter mousse features a blend of creamy peanut butter, silken tofu, and maple syrup, creating a deliciously smooth pudding. The recipe takes about 15 minutes to prepare and serves 4 people.
Ingredients
- 1 cup creamy peanut butter
- 1 package (12 oz) silken tofu, drained
- 1/2 cup maple syrup or agave nectar
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1/4 cup cocoa powder (optional for chocolate flavor)
- Pinch of salt
- Chocolate ganache for topping (optional)
Instructions
- Blend the Ingredients: In a blender or food processor, combine the peanut butter, silken tofu, maple syrup, vanilla extract, cocoa powder (if using), and salt. Blend until smooth and creamy.
- Taste and Adjust: Taste the mousse and adjust sweetness if necessary by adding more maple syrup.
- Chill the Mousse: Transfer the mousse to serving bowls or cups and refrigerate for at least 1 hour to allow it to set.
- Serve: Top with chocolate ganache if desired, and enjoy your delicious vegan peanut butter mousse!
Cook and Prep Times
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Chill Time: 1 hour
- Total Time: 1 hour 15 minutes
